Transaction 4388a8f6a675979540d0eb1fa2c105d07d93f7249b8d73b5201121275d24319d

220 Input
1 Outputs
  • 4388a8f6a675979540d0eb1fa2c105d07d93f7249b8d73b5201121275d24319d:0
  • value  81594555548
    address  3GPZEFsTbk7HLF9JSSefCcBFQDta31bWzw